Haverford, PA · Villanova, PA · Source: IPEDS federal database
| Haverford College | Villanova University | |
|---|---|---|
| Acceptance Rate | 12.4% | 27.0% |
| In-State Tuition | $70,688 | $67,776 |
| Out-of-State Tuition | $70,688 | $67,776 |
| Average Net Price | $26,535 | $37,201 |
| Graduation Rate | 90.0% | 92.0% |
| Total Enrollment | 1,431 | 10,041 |
| Student-Faculty Ratio | 8 | 10 |
GradFax Analysis
Haverford College accepts 12.4% of applicants. Villanova University accepts 27.0%. Haverford College's tuition is $70,688. Villanova University's is $67,776. Villanova University is cheaper. Six-year graduation rates are close: 90% at Haverford College, 92% at Villanova University.
Bottom Line
After aid, the average student pays $26,535/year at Haverford College and $37,201/year at Villanova University. Haverford College is cheaper for most people.
